Macpower Digital Assets Edge Private Limited is Hiring a Field installation technician Near West Chester, PA

Summary :

Fully understand and implement Customer's standards of safety, installation quality, processes, and communication methods.

Understand and enforce standards of professionalism, quality, safety, metrics, and processes.

Adhere to policies, procedures and directives.

Maintains positive relations with Customers.

Understand and comply with installer task descriptions and restrictions as defined within Telcordia GR-1275-CORE.

Responsible for team tool kit and team van (including proper appearance and maintenance of van).

Escalate any issues to your immediate Supervisor for assistance with resolution.

Roles & Responsibilities :

Perform an assessment of AC and DC power risk related to the project and develop a plan to mitigate the risk. This assessment is to include (but not be limited to) arc flash hazard protection requirements.

The risk and associated mitigation plan are to be reviewed during the project kick-off call.

Write DMOPS in adherence with Customer, vendor, and industry standards and requirements.

Perform an inventory of materials against the BOM and Engineering documents. Report any shortages to the Project Supervisor.

Communicate with the Project Engineer to resolve any discrepancies.

Install and / or modify cable conveyances and office infrastructure per the Engineering documents and customer standards

Pull cable into place per the Engineering documents and on-site installation layout.

Demonstrate proper lacing technique.

Install, replace, or repair DC power equipment, batteries, and associated equipment per the Engineering documents and customer standards

Perform additions, removals, and modifications on working equipment and circuits including circuit modifications, software additions or upgrades, power transition work, and addition or removal of batteries.

Perform initial programming of DC power plant controllers.

Input changes into DC power plant controllers as required.

Perform Midtronics battery testing and interpret results; address any notable deviations.

Perform battery charging per customer's standards.

Complete quality checklist at completion of the job and ensure correction of any quality non-conformances.

Working with the customer (if required) or independently, perform equipment test and turn-up.

Mark / correct office record drawings.

Perform site surveys independently.
